[Ayuda] Velocimetro
#1

Hola, tengo el velocнmetro Kspeedo, y quiero que al subir a un auto solo lo vea el conductor, no el acompaсante, ya que si el acompaсante sube y luego se baja, el velocнmetro se buguea.
їComo puedo hacer que el velocнmetro solo lo vea el conductor?
Reply
#2

Utiliza:

https://sampwiki.blast.hk/wiki/OnPlayerStateChange
Reply
#3

Es bastante simple. El callback "OnPlayerStateChange" es llamado cuando tu estado cambia a uno a otro. Aqui te va un ejemplo:

pawn Код:
public OnPlayerStateChange(playerid, newstate, oldstate)
{
    if(oldstate == PLAYER_STATE_ONFOOT && newstate == PLAYER_STATE_DRIVER)
    {
        // Enseсa los textdraws del Velocimetro aqui.
    }
    if(oldstate == PLAYER_STATE_DRIVER && newstate == PLAYER_STATE_ONFOOT)
    {
        // Esconda los textdraws del Velocimetro aqui.
    }
    return 1;
}
Reply
#4

Puedes usar GetPlayerVehicleSeat para determinar en que asiento estб el jugador. Si el asiento no es 0, no muestres el velocнmetro.
Reply
#5

Muchas gracias ya lo solucione
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)